分析了法国、澳大利亚和美国的现代有轨电车运营事故统计报告与道路交通事故报告,从现代有轨电车运营事故类型、人员伤亡分布规律、事故发生地点分布规律、不同路权下事故分布规律,以及事故参与者行为等方面,总结了现代有轨电车运营事故的发生机理与影响因素,得出了对于道路交叉口处安全状态的研究是现代有轨电车运营安全管理的核心,路权的封闭与隔离能提高现代有轨电车的运营安全等结论,对我国现代有轨电车运营管理与安全评价具有指导意义。  相似文献

交通事件和干预作用影响下的高速公路车流波分析   总被引:5,自引:0,他引:5  
运用流体力学车流波理论,分析了交通事件和干预措施综合作用下对车流状态的影响,建立了基于车速———交通密度一般模型下的车流波波速模型、干预作用产生的干预波和交通事件影响产生的集结波、启动波、消散波相互作用产生的车流波位置和对应时刻模型以及分流干预措施解除时刻模型.这些模型或关键参数的确定,为有效确定事件处理方案,尽快消除拥挤或阻塞提供了理论依据.  相似文献

提出了一种基于模糊聚类技术和RBF神经网络的混合智能高速公路事件自动探测算法,同时改进了用于RBF神经网络训练的Oils(正交最小二乘)选择算法.仿真实验证明,改进的OLS选择算法大大提高了RBF神经网络的训练速度同时具有无须事先确定RBF中心的优点,将之运用于公路事件探测可以获得满意的性能.  相似文献

This study aims to develop a maximum likelihood regression tree-based model to predict subway incident delays, which are major negative impacts caused by subway incidents from the commuter’s perspective. Using the Hong Kong subway incident data from 2005 and 2009, a tree comprising 10 terminal nodes is selected to predict subway incident delays in a case study. An accelerated failure time (AFT) analysis is conducted separately for each terminal node. The goodness-of-fit results show that our developed model outperforms the traditional AFT models with fixed and random effects because it can overcome the heterogeneity problem and over-fitting effects. The developed model is beneficial for subway engineers looking to propose effective strategies for reducing subway incident delays, especially in super-large-sized cities with huge public travel demand.  相似文献

ABSTRACT

Incidents are a major source of traffic congestion and can lead to long and unpredictable delays, deteriorating traffic operations and adverse environmental impacts. The emergence of connected vehicles and communication technologies has enabled travelers to use real-time traffic information. The ability to exchange traffic information among vehicles has tremendous potential impacts on network performance especially in the case of non-recurrent congestion. To this end, this paper utilizes a microscopic simulation model of traffic in El Paso, Texas to investigate the impacts of incidents on traffic operation and fuel consumption at different market penetration rates (MPR) of connected vehicles. Several scenarios are implemented and tested to determine the impacts of incidents on network performance in an urban area. The scenarios are defined by changing the duration of incidents and the number of lanes closed. This study also shows how communication technology affects network performance in response to congestion. The results of the study demonstrate the potential effectiveness of connected vehicle technology in improving network performance. For an incident with a duration of 900?s and MPR of 80%, total fuel consumption and total travel time decreased by approximately 20%; 26% was observed in network-wide travel time and fuel consumption at 100% MPR.  相似文献

Seafarer health and well-being has long been a concern in the shipping industry because of the unique characteristics of working at sea. This paper aims to identify the role of burnout in seafarer health and well-being and its effect on safety. In particular, we differentiated seafarer burnout into personal and work-related burnout to reflect the ambiguous distinction between rest and work in seafarers’ job environment. We also investigate the effectiveness of emotion regulation for seafarers to reduce burnout. This study proposes a conceptual framework to identify the causal relationship between occupational stress, sleepiness, emotion regulation, burnout, and incidents at sea. To verify the proposed framework, scales were adapted from established scales in the literature; a cross-sectional survey was also conducted to collect empirical data for analysis with path and simultaneous equation models. The analysis results revealed that personal and work-related burnout in seafarers are mutually affected; however, only work-related burnout exerts a direct effect on incidents. Reappraisal is an effective emotion regulation strategy in seafarers to reduce personal burnout, but not work-related burnout. Occupational stress and sleepiness exert positive effects on both personal and work-related burnout; yet, their effect on incidents is mediated by work-related burnout.  相似文献

利用博弈论为工程安全监管提供一个示范,提出了“边际政绩收益”概念,为政府安全监管提供一个参考指标,并且通过安全监管博弈分析,建立博弈模型,对模型进行求解,对工程监管决策中可控因素进行计算,得到一些有利于我国工程安全监管决策的结论.  相似文献

我国目前处在突发公共事件的高发时期,而且在未来很长一段时间内,我国都将面临突发公共事件所带来的严峻考验。越来越多的人认识到,加强重大危机应对工作势在必行。本文作者从信息化建设的角度对突发公共事件应对措施进行了研究,结合海事工作实际提出了应急指挥系统的功能需求及建设思路,并对系统建设中要注意的问题进行了分析,期望对读者有所启发和帮助。  相似文献
